Modern Slavery Statement

Introduction

This statement sets our GIR Holdings actions aimed at ensuring that there is no slavery or human trafficking in its business and its supply chain. This statement relates to actions and activities during the financial year 1 April 2020 to 31 March 2021.

Organizational Structure and Business

Headquartered in India we have regional offices in US, UK, Tokyo, and Sao Paulo. GIR Holdings is an independent provider of strategic market research. We create data and analysis on thousands of products and services around the world. Given the nature of what we do, we believe there is a low risk of slavery or human trafficking having a connection with us business activities. As an international company we recognize there are global differences in accepted practices with regards to human rights and labor, we comply fully with all aspects of labor law in all countries in which we operate and where our standards exceed those of local legislation, we apply our own. GIR Holdings HR and CSR team are responsible for policies and procedures relating to anti-slavery.

Recruitment

Our recruitment takes place through a combination of direct advertising on our website, using social media such as LinkedIn and relying on referrals from employees within our organization. All employees who join us are subject to checks to ensure they are genuine applicants operating as free agents.

Fair Wage

Since 2011 GIR Holdings has been committed to ensuring all staff members are paid a realistic wage. In our London office we ensure contracted staff members earning an hourly rate are paid the London Living Wage and globally reviews are undertaken annually to ensure we are meeting the same standards.

Whistleblowing

We encourage all employees, contractors, and other business partners to report any concerns related to its direct activities or supply chains. Our whistleblowing procedure is designed to make it easy for employees to make disclosures, without fear of retaliation.
